What Does a Heating Tune-Up Include?
Our expert technicians at Airflow Heating and Cooling follow a meticulous, multi-point inspection and maintenance process:
- Burners and Coils Cleaning: Over time, burners and heat exchanger coils accumulate soot and debris. Cleaning these components improves combustion efficiency and prevents flame irregularities that can cause carbon monoxide risks.
- Combustion Analysis: We test the fuel-to-air ratio in your burner to ensure safe, efficient combustion. Proper combustion reduces fuel waste and harmful emissions.
- Airflow and Duct Inspection: Blocked or leaky ducts decrease heating efficiency and indoor air quality. Our technicians inspect ductwork for leaks, obstructions, and insulation issues to promote optimal airflow.
- Thermostat Calibration: An improperly calibrated thermostat can lead to inaccurate temperature control and wasted energy. We verify and adjust settings so your system heats your home evenly and according to your preferences.
- Safety Controls Testing: Safety is paramount. We evaluate all critical safety components, including limit switches and flame sensors, to verify they are functioning correctly and protect your home.
- General Component Check: From the blower motor to electrical connections, every part is inspected for wear or damage, allowing early detection of potential future repairs.

Recommended Frequency for Heating Tune-Ups in Orange
To maintain optimal performance and safety, Airflow Heating and Cooling recommends scheduling a heating tune-up at least once every year, ideally before the heating season begins in late fall. Some Orange homeowners benefit from more frequent inspections if their systems are older, heavily used, or exposed to environmental contaminants unique to the area (such as dust from rural landscapes or pollen).

Additional Tips for Maintaining Heating Efficiency in Orange, VA Homes
Beyond professional tune-ups, homeowners can adopt simple strategies to boost heating performance and comfort:
- Regularly Replace Filters: Dirty filters restrict airflow and decrease efficiency. Change them monthly during heavy use.
- Seal Drafts: Inspect windows and doors to prevent warm air leakage and cold drafts.
- Use Programmable Thermostats: Schedule heating cycles to optimize energy use during occupied and unoccupied periods.
- Keep Vents Clear: Avoid blocking floor and wall registers to maintain proper room airflow.
- Consider Zoning Systems: For uneven heating issues in larger homes, zoning can distribute warmth more effectively.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: How long does a heating tune-up typically take?
A: Most heating tune-ups are completed within 60 to 90 minutes, depending on the system’s size and condition.
Q: Can a heating tune-up reduce my energy bills?
A: Yes, by cleaning and calibrating your system, tune-ups improve efficiency, thus lowering energy consumption and utility costs.
Q: When is the best time to schedule a heating tune-up in Orange, VA?
A: It’s best to schedule your heating tune-up in early fall before the heating season begins to ensure your system is ready when temperatures drop.
Q: What happens if my heating system needs repairs during the tune-up?
A: Our technicians will inform you of any issues discovered during the tune-up and provide recommendations and estimates for necessary repairs.
Q: Do heating tune-ups include filter replacement?
A: While some services might replace basic filters, we generally check and advise on filter condition; homeowners should replace disposable filters regularly themselves for continued efficiency.
